Default acceleration/deceleration mode
This value is treated as the data in the “Acceleration/deceleration mode” field corresponding to the applicable
position number when a target position has been written to the unregistered position table.
The factory setting is “0 [Trapezoid].
To change the default acceleration/deceleration pattern, set an applicable value in parameter No. 52 as shown
below.

Current-limiting value during home return
The factory setting conforms to the standard specification of the actuator.
Increasing this setting will increase the home return torque.
This setting need not be changed in normal conditions of use. However, if an increased slide resistance causes
the home return to complete before the correct position depending on the affixing method, load condition or other
factor when the actuator is used in a vertical application, the value set in parameter No. 13 must be increased.
Please contact IAI.
Speed override
Use this parameter when moving the actuator at a slower speed to prevent danger when the system is initially
started for test operation.
When move commands are issued from the PLC, the moving speed set in the “Speed” field of the position table
can be overridden by the value set by parameter No. 46.
Actual moving speed = [Speed set in the position table] x [Value of parameter No. 46]
100
Example) Value in the “Speed” field of the position table 500 (mm/s)
Value of parameter No. 46 20 (%)
Under the above settings, the actual moving speed becomes 100 mm/s.
The minimum setting unit is “1 [%],” while the input range is “1 to 100 [%].” The factory setting is “100 [%].”
(Note) This parameter is ignored for move commands from the PC and teaching pendant.
Safety speed
This parameter defines the feed speed to be applied during manual operation.
The factory setting is “100 [mm/sec].”
To change this speed, set an optimal value in parameter No. 35.
Take note that the maximum speed is limited to “250 [mm/s]” and that you should set a speed not exceeding this
value.
